2 soldiers slain in NPA ambush in Albay

LEGAZPI CITY, Philippines  —  Two Army soldiers were killed in an ambush staged by suspected New People’s Army (NPA) rebels in Camalig, Albay on Tuesday.

Pfcs. Cris Aron Consolation and Emmanuel Clarinal of the 2nd Infantry Battalion were riding a motorcycle when they were waylaid in Barangay Panoypoy at about 4:45 p.m., Chief Inspector Malou Calubaquib, Bicol police spokesperson, said, citing a report of the Camalig police.

“The soldiers were unarmed and would participate in a basketball game with villagers when they were shot,” Capt. Joas Pramis of the 9th Infantry Division said.

Pramis said a manhunt for the rebels is ongoing.
